The Complexity of Material Selection

Designers must consider various aspects when specifying materials, including:

  • Aesthetic Appeal: The material’s color, texture, and finish must align with the overall design vision.
  • Durability: Materials should withstand the wear and tear of everyday use, particularly in high-traffic areas.
  • Maintenance: Ease of cleaning and long-term upkeep are critical for maintaining the beauty and functionality of surfaces.
  • Cost: Budget constraints often dictate material choices, requiring designers to balance quality with affordability.
  • Sustainability: Increasingly, designers are prioritizing eco-friendly materials that minimize environmental impact.

Given the complexity of these considerations, having a reliable slab distributor can significantly alleviate the burden of material selection.

Choosing the Right Distributor

When selecting a slab distributor, designers should consider several factors to ensure they are making the best choice for their projects:

1. Evaluate Inventory and Product Range

Look for a distributor that offers a comprehensive selection of materials, including various types of quartz, porcelain, and natural stone. Builder Stone Global specializes in premium surfaces, making it an ideal choice for designers seeking high-quality options.

2. Assess Expertise and Support

Consider the level of expertise and support provided by the distributor. A knowledgeable team can offer valuable insights and assist with technical questions, making the specification process smoother.

3. Review Logistics and Delivery Options

Efficient logistics are crucial for timely project completion. Ensure the distributor has a reliable delivery system in place, including regional logistics and nationwide shipping options.

4. Check for Partnership Programs

Many distributors offer partnership programs that provide additional benefits, such as discounts, exclusive access to new products, and marketing support. Builder Stone Global has a dealer and fabricator partnership program that enhances collaboration and mutual growth.

5. Read Customer Testimonials

Feedback from other designers and fabricators can provide insights into the distributor’s reliability and quality of service. Look for testimonials that highlight positive experiences and successful collaborations.
